What type of bait works best?

Bait effectiveness varies by animal. Peanut butter, nuts, seeds, and small pieces of fruit are generally effective for rodents and squirrels.

How often should I check the trap?

It is recommended to check the trap at least twice a day, in the morning and evening, to ensure the animal's welfare and to promptly handle captured pests.

Can this trap be used in the rain?

The trap is made of galvanised steel, which offers rust resistance. However, it's best to check the mechanism after rain and dry the trap afterwards to maintain its condition and functionality.

How do I clean the trap after use?

Clean the trap with mild soap and water. Rinse thoroughly and allow it to air dry completely before storing or re-deploying.

Troubleshooting

Trap does not trigger when an animal enters.

Ensure the bait is placed correctly beyond the trigger plate. Check that the trigger mechanism is clean and moves freely without obstruction. Verify the door is properly set to be held by the trigger.

Animal escapes after being trapped.

Confirm the door has fully closed and latched. Ensure there are no gaps or damage to the trap structure that could allow an escape. Check that the trigger mechanism is sensitive enough.

Trap appears to be rusting.

While made of rust-resistant material, clean and dry the trap thoroughly after each use, especially if exposed to moisture. Store in a dry environment when not in use.

Animal is injured in the trap.

This trap is designed for humane capture. Ensure the door closes smoothly and does not slam. Check the trap frequently to minimize stress on the captured animal and facilitate a quick release or relocation.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

  1. Open the trap door fully.
  2. Place your chosen bait (e.g., peanut butter, seeds, nuts) just beyond the trigger plate inside the trap.
  3. Gently set the spring-loaded door mechanism so it is held open by the trigger.
  4. Ensure the trap is placed on a stable, level surface in an area frequented by the target pest.

Compatibility:

This trap is primarily designed for small to medium-sized animals such as:

  • Rats
  • Squirrels
  • Mice
  • Weasels
  • Chipmunks

It is not intended for larger animals, as they may not fit or could potentially damage the trap.

Care:

  • After each use, clean the trap thoroughly with soap and water to remove any scent. Rinse well and allow to dry completely before resetting.
  • The galvanised steel is rust-resistant, but prolonged exposure to harsh weather without drying may eventually cause surface rust. Store in a dry place when not in use.
  • Regularly inspect the trigger mechanism and door for smooth operation.
